Transaction 52ae97e068826a851773012459c77cd571aeb2367421b5606f8c660b2668eb25
1 Input
1 Output
-
52ae97e068826a851773012459c77cd571aeb2367421b5606f8c660b2668eb25:0
- value
- 78220
- script pubkey
- OP_0 OP_PUSHBYTES_20 df610e3490bd7024e07059f117b13f684c75189f
- address
- bc1qmassudysh4czfcrst8c30vfldpx82xyl8lc9l9